Milka Trnina was a celebrated Croatian opera singer, renowned for her powerful voice and dramatic stage presence. Born in 1863, she gained international fame as a prima donna, performing at prestigious venues across Europe and captivating audiences with her interpretations of roles in operas by composers like Wagner and Verdi. Her concert in Zagreb in 1898 was particularly memorable, as it marked her triumphant return to her homeland, where she received an overwhelming reception filled with flowers and applause from devoted fans. Throughout her career, Trnina was recognized not only for her vocal talent but also for her contributions to the cultural heritage of Croatia, earning her the affectionate title of 'the Croatian nightingale.'
